For more than 20 years, Beatlemania Again has performed at sold-out venues throughout the United States and Canada. The production follows the Beatles’ remarkable career chronologically, beginning with the energy and tailored black suits of their historic 1964 appearance on The Ed Sullivan Show.
The journey then moves into the psychedelic colors and groundbreaking music of the Sgt. Pepper’s Lonely Hearts Club Band era before arriving at the group’s later recordings and famous 1969 rooftop performance atop Apple Corps headquarters.
More than 30 Beatles favorites are performed live throughout the show, accompanied by three major costume changes and authentic period-style instruments. Hofner basses, Rickenbacker and Gretsch guitars, Vox amplifiers, and Black Oyster Pearl Ludwig drums help recreate both the look and unmistakable sound of the 1960s.
The show is designed as a musical journey through the Beatles’ evolution, with each chapter recreating a distinct period in the band’s history.
Relive the excitement of the Beatles’ arrival in America, complete with the familiar suits, early instruments, youthful energy, and songs that launched a worldwide phenomenon.
The stage transforms with vibrant costumes and psychedelic style as the music enters one of the most imaginative and influential periods in popular music history.
The final chapter celebrates the band’s mature sound, later recordings, and unforgettable rooftop farewell with music from the closing years of the Beatles’ career.
The Summer Beach Jam is Ventnor’s Saturday-night summer concert series, bringing free live entertainment to the S. Newport Avenue band stage near the beach and boardwalk. With the Atlantic Ocean only steps away, it offers one of the most distinctly Ventnor ways to spend a summer evening.
Food and craft vendors begin welcoming visitors at 5:30 PM while the performers complete their sound check. Live music begins at 6:30 PM, giving concertgoers plenty of time to choose a spot, explore the vendors, pick up dinner or a snack, and settle in before the show.
